Examines how De revolutionibus, the technical sixteenth-century treatise by Nicolaus Copernicus, helped launch a revolution more profound than the Reformation and how the six hundred surviving copies have evolved into million-dollar cultural icons. Reprint.
About the Author: Owen Gingerich is senior astronomer emeritus at the Smithsonian Astrophysical Observatory and research professor of astronomy and the history of science at Harvard University.
